A celebration of Instruct-ERIC: achievements, impact and expanding ambitions

 

On 16 September 2020, a virtual event was held to celebrate the achievements of Instruct-ERIC in the time since achieving European Research Infrastructure Consortium (ERIC) status in 2017.

During an afternoon of selected talks, the Instruct-ULTRA-funded event celebrated the achievements of Instruct-ERIC, recognising the hard work and commitment of the consortium, staff, supporters and users, in the wider context of the successful European Research Infrastructure landscape. The event brought together Instruct’s key stakeholders, including centre staff, policy makers, and leading scientists from the EU and beyond.

The event was expertly chaired by Professor Joel Sussman, co-director of the Structural Proteomic Centre in Israel and Professor of Structural Biology at the Weizmann Institute of Science.

Highlights from the event included an insightful talk from Roberta Zobbi, Deputy Head of Research and Industrial Infrastructures Unit at the European Commission, on the vision for Research Infrastructures in Europe. This was followed by a talk from Instruct Director, Professor David Stuart’s, highlighting the achievements of Instruct-ERIC.

Instruct Director Professor David Stuart gives a talk on the achievements of Instruct-ERIC.

Further talks were given on open access and data sharing, collaborations between Research Infrastructures, the impact of Instruct-ERIC on Horizon Europe missions, and positioning Instruct-ERIC as a scientific influencer. Following the talks, a panel Q&A session provided participants with an opportunity to ask their questions to key representatives involved with European Research Infrastructures.

Certainly, the event revealed an exciting future ahead for Instruct-ERIC and Research Infrastructures in Europe, with many new collaborative opportunities that will enable important scientific and technological developments in the years to come.
